About this Event

The Aspire Center, School of Business and Economics, and the Athletic Department are combining forces to present Carthage College's brand new Fall Business Career Showcase.

The Fall Business Career Showcase allows businesses from accounting, finance, management, marketing, and many other areas to discuss full-time and internship candidates from multiple venues and schools, such as Carthage, Carroll University, and Concordia University of WI. More schools may be added at a later date.

Employers may hold interviews at their discretion later, either in-person or virtually, via the employer’s preferred platform.

We are anticipating more than 250 students participating in this event.

When: Wednesday, September 24th, 2025, from 11:00 a.m. to 1:30 p.m.

Where: Carthage College, 2001 Alford Park Dr, Kenosha, WI

GENERAL EVENT DETAILS

Please update and post all internships and full-time career opportunities on your Handshake page. We share this information with students and campus colleagues in our materials and programming leading up to the events.

Each employer registration includes space for up to 2 employer representatives and a 6' table. The tables for the Career Fair have tablecloths, but you are welcome to bring your own. The booth space is approximately 10 feet wide, so please ensure that your display will fit behind or on your table.

Lunch will be provided.
